Mark Kessel is a securities attorney based in New York, New York. They have 60+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1966. Admitted to practice in New York (1966) and California (1979). Educated at Syracuse Law School (J.D., 1966) and City College of the City University of New York (B.A., 1963). Recognitions include AV Preeminent. Serands clients in New York, NY and the surrounding metropolitan area.
